The Working Mechanism of an AC Battery Charger

Before we delve into the details of AC battery chargers, let's understand how they work. The charger's working principle is relatively simple; it converts the voltage and current from the AC source to the desired output for the connected device's battery.

AC battery chargers use a rectifier circuit to convert AC power to high-voltage DC power, which gets passed through a transformer that adjusts the voltage levels. The DC power is then filtered for any remaining alternating waveform components, resulting in a steady and pure DC voltage that is safe for the battery to charge.

Types of AC Battery Chargers

There are two main types of AC battery chargers: linear and switch-mode.

A linear charger operates by decreasing the voltage across a series of resistors to set the appropriate charging voltage. As the battery's charge level rises, the resistance also increases, reducing the charging current. Linear chargers tend to be less complicated and less expensive but are slower and less efficient than switch-mode chargers.

A switch-mode charger works by continuously adjusting the voltage and current levels to maintain the optimum charging rate. They can adjust the voltage based on the battery's charge level, resulting in faster charging times and higher efficiency.

Factors to Consider when Choosing an AC Battery Charger

When choosing an AC battery charger, there are several factors to consider.

Charging Time: The charging time requirements depend on the battery's capacity, so make sure you choose a charger that can deliver the required current and voltage for your battery within the necessary time frame.

Portability: If you plan to use your charger on-the-go or outdoors, make sure you choose one that is lightweight, compact, and portable.

Charging Modes: Look for a charger with multiple charging modes, such as trickle charge, fast charge, and maintenance charge. This allows you to choose the mode that suits your battery's needs and helps extend its lifespan.

Compatibility: Make sure the charger is compatible with your battery type and size. Most chargers support several types of batteries, but double-check to avoid any compatibility issues.

What is an AC battery charger?

An AC battery charger is a device that uses alternating current (AC) to charge rechargeable batteries. It converts the AC voltage into the DC voltage required by the battery and delivers a controlled amount of charge to the battery.

How does an AC battery charger work?

AC battery chargers work by converting the AC voltage from a wall outlet into the DC voltage needed by the battery. The charger also controls the rate of charge, so that the battery is not overcharged, which can cause damage to the battery and reduce its lifespan.

What kind of batteries can be charged with an AC battery charger?

An AC battery charger can be used to charge many types of rechargeable batteries, including lead-acid, nickel-cadmium (NiCad), nickel-metal-hydride (NiMH), and lithium-ion (Li-ion) batteries.

2. How does an AC battery charger work?

AC battery chargers typically consist of a transformer, rectifier, and voltage regulator. The transformer converts the high voltage AC power from the outlet into a lower voltage AC power. The rectifier then converts this AC power into a pulsating DC power. Finally, the voltage regulator ensures that the output voltage is steady and within the appropriate range for the battery being charged.

3. Can I use any AC battery charger for all types of batteries?

No, you cannot use any AC battery charger for all types of batteries. Different types of batteries have different charging requirements, such as voltage and current specifications. It is important to match the charger to the specific type of battery you are using to ensure safe and efficient charging. Using an incompatible charger may lead to overcharging or damaging the battery.

4. Are AC battery chargers universal?

Some AC battery chargers are designed to be universal, meaning they can charge multiple types of batteries. These chargers often come with adjustable voltage settings or interchangeable charging plates to accommodate different battery sizes and chemistries. However, not all AC battery chargers are universal, so it is essential to check the compatibility before using them for specific batteries.

5. Are there any safety precautions to consider when using an AC battery charger?

Yes, there are several safety precautions to keep in mind when using an AC battery charger. Here are a few important ones:

  • Read and follow the manufacturer's instructions carefully to ensure proper usage and charging procedures.
  • Avoid using damaged chargers or those with frayed cables to prevent electrical hazards.
  • Do not overcharge batteries beyond the recommended charging time as it may cause overheating or even explosions.
  • Keep the charger away from flammable materials and in a well-ventilated area to prevent potential fire risks.
  • Unplug the charger when not in use to reduce energy consumption and minimize the risk of electrical accidents.
